Kayes Dag Dag Airport at a glance

Kayes Dag Dag Airport is a medium airport in Kayes, Kayes Region, Mali, known to airline systems as KYS. The field elevation of 164 ft (50 m) is the number every arriving pilot dials against QNH — circuit heights and initial approach altitudes at GAKD are all figured from it. The airport handles scheduled commercial service, so expect controlled procedures, published approaches and commercial traffic in the pattern.

The single runway, 09/27, offers 8,858 ft (2700 m) of asp surface, with runway lighting for night operations. Runway numbers give magnetic orientation: runway 09 points roughly 90° magnetic.

Flight-planning notes for Kayes Dag Dag Airport

Density altitude is the quiet performance-killer at any field: on a hot day the 164 ft field elevation of Kayes Dag Dag Airport can translate into a substantially higher density altitude, stretching take-off rolls and flattening climb rates — run the numbers rather than trusting the feel of a standard day. Expect published instrument procedures, controlled airspace and clearance requirements; slots and handling may apply to general aviation traffic.
